学习
实践
活动
工具
TVP
写文章

python 穷举指定长度密码例子

本程序可根据给定字符字典,穷举指定长度所有字符串: def get_pwd(str, num): if(num == 1): for x in str: yield x else 补充知识:Python 穷举法, 二分法 与牛顿-拉夫逊方法求解平方根性能对比 穷举法, 二分法 与牛顿-拉夫逊方法求解平方根优劣,从左到右依次递优。 牛顿-拉夫逊秒出,没有任何停顿。 *numberSqureRoot)) print("squre root of %s is %s " %(numberTarget,numberSqureRoot)) 以上这篇python 穷举指定长度密码例子就是小编分享给大家全部内容了

40510

Discourse 如何限制注册用户密码长度

在默认情况下 Discourse 限制用户输入密码长度要超过 10 个字符。 这个实在太长了,用户交互性不好。 如何修改这个密码长度到 6 位? 你可以登录后台管理员界面,然后搜索关键字 password 你可以看到上面有 2 个选项,一个登录用户密码,一个管理员密码。 在默认情况下,登录用户密码 10 位,管理员密码 15 位。 系统允许最短密码位数为 8 位。 所以你没有办法设置到 6 位。 为了更好交互,我们建议登录用户密码设置为 8 位,管理员密码可以考虑设置为 10 位,或者都设置为 8 位。 你可以修改上面的配置,然后保存就可以了。 修改配置后,保存退出。

26200
  • 广告
    关闭

    热门业务场景教学

    个人网站、项目部署、开发环境、游戏服务器、图床、渲染训练等免费搭建教程,多款云服务器20元起。

  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    世界密码日 | 警惕!你密码“弱密码”吗?

    图 | 网络 01丨身份认证 口令身份认证一种方式。无论在互联网世界或是在区块链系统中,身份认证保障系统安全重要手段之一。身份认证识别和确认数据或者实体真实性一种行为。 一方面,口令安全性受限于用户选择口令强度。口令需要具备一定强度,即具有较高信息熵。但一般来说,在没有指导情况下,口令选择具有偏向性,会偏好于特定组成和长度,如常见姓名生日组合。 据知名分析公司 SlashData 等调查,“123456”、“qwerty”以及“password”等都是常见密码。其中“123456”更是弱密码排行榜上长居榜首。 对于普通用户来说,首先避开姓名生日组合、“123456”等弱口令,选择一定强度口令。一般来说,挑选一定长度随机字符值来作为口令会使得口令强度大大增加。另外,在不同网站上应该采用不同口令。 当然,请不要把保护数字资产口令告诉我们,我们会假装看不到。 最后最后,世界密码日快乐!

    66730

    TCP报文长度由什么确定

    MTU:最大传输单元,以太网MTU为1500Bytes MSS:最大分解大小,为每次TCP数据包每次传输最大数据分段大小,由发送端通知接收端,发送大于MTU就会被分片 TCP最小数据长度为 1460Bytes 这个跟具体传输网络有关,以太网MTU为1500字节,InternetMTU为576字节。 MTU网络层传输单元,那么MSS = MTU - 20字节(IP首部) - 20字节(TCP首部)。所以以太网MSS为1460字节,而InternetMSS为536字节。 TCP最大负载65535-40Bbytes TCP报文段最大负载为65495字节,因为每个数据段必须适合IP载荷能力,不能超过65535字节,IP头20B,TCP包头20B,故最大负载为65535

    2.1K40

    与圆心距离相等长度相等

    42320

    oracle中varchar2类型最大长度_oracle修改字段长度sql

    大家好,我架构君,一个会写代码吟诗架构师。今天说一说oracle中varchar2类型最大长度_oracle修改字段长度sql,希望能够帮助大家进步!!! 在设计表时候,设计了一个未来可能会使用字段,varchar2类型,长度较长。因为目前不会使用,因此想到这样设计会否暂用额外空间。 根据VARCHAR2定义,为可变长 度字符串,因此应该不会占用多余空间,在找了一些资料之后,验证了这个结论。 但是会否影响插入或者查询效率呢,本人没有研究过数据库底层原理,但基于基本逻辑判断 以及对数据库信任,拍脑袋判断影响不大。 因此,在80%后期会使用字段,可以预先创建,否则,还是等需要再建吧,以免造成误解。 今天文章到此就结束了,感谢您阅读,Java架构师必看祝您升职加薪,年年好运。

    30130

    如何保护用户密码

    只要有会员系统网站就会涉及到密码,如果处理不好就会造成前阵子那种事。下面我就说说我在开发时如何处理密码这块功能。    首先,密码必须加密,但简单MD5加密已经没有太大意义,为了防止字典破解,我会给密码加盐后在MD5,我一般用用户自己密码当盐。    这一步操作后基本上就不怕数据库暴露了,接下来要做就是前端了。我们知道,HTTP传输协议明文,也就是可能用户密码还没有到后端,在传输途中就可能泄露了,那要怎么解决呢?    其实我们完全可以把加密这一步骤放到前端来,密码加密好后再进行传输,这样传输数据如果被抓取,也是加密过密码。    既然要在前台加密,那就需要一个用来实现加密js,我这推荐一个MD5.js,调用方法可以看下源码,没几行代码,而且也没有压缩过。   这就是我对密码这块做2个处理,希望对大家有帮助。

    8810

    乌克兰国防系统密码真的123456?

    最近有一篇热文《乌克兰国防军队系统账号和密码分别是 admin 和 123456!》 提到乌克兰武装部队“第聂伯罗”军事自动化控制系统,服务器网络保护十分原始,用户名和密码“admin 123456”。这是一篇“观察者网”报道,并非小道消息,但这是2018年旧闻了。 至于现在密码改了没有,咱也不知道,咱也不敢问。 俄乌冲突爆发后,网络安全领域可以说是双方另一个战场。 2月24日,乌克兰主要政府网站“在遭受一系列网络攻击后”无法打开。 8 Web代码安全漏洞深度剖析 作者:曹玉杰 王乐 李家辉 孔韬循 编著 推荐语:代码审计网络攻防实战核心技术之一,这本书从环境建设、实战剖析、业务安全三个维度展开,作者及其团队多年一线实战经验精华凝结 尤其对SQL注入、跨站脚本、跨站请求、文件类型、代码和命令执行等漏洞分析阐述与实战分析,具有重要学习指导意义和实战指引价值,多位网络安全专家联袂推荐。

    27920

    su root, incorrect password, 密码正确

    CentOs系统,在使用su 时提示:incorrect password, 但是密码确实是正确. 看看下面这句是不是设成有效了 auth required pam_whell.so use_uid 在看看 /etc/login.defs 文件 是不是有下面一句 SU_WHEEL_ONLY yes 如果, 注释掉. 二.看/bin/su文件属性是否'rwsr-xr-x',如果不是请改过。 chmod u+s /bin/su  如果u - 其他任意用户都可以,某一特定用户不行,解决方法: 记下该用户uid和gid及相关属组,删除,重建,赋予同样gid和组id 注释:

    2.3K20

    如何获取全域用户明文密码

    在默认情况下,域上服务器包含两个DLL,其中 seccli 负责实现密码安全策略,也就我们常用GPO了 ? 我们今天主题,就是如何滥用这个机制,实现一个密码策略插件,以记录所有域用户密码 一家上市公司,为了符合SOX 404审计要求,密码每三个月就要强制修改一次,刚好可以触发这个机制 查了下官方文档,一个密码插件需要导出三个函数 其中 PasswordFilter 负责检查密码是否合规;PasswordChangeNotify 在工作站上执行,负责告知工作站用户密码变更。 最终源代码和64位DLL可以点击阅读原文下载(使用 build.cmd 编译) 安装插件 我们登陆域控,将编译好 SecureFilter.dll 复制到 %system32% 目录, 然后打开注册表 写在最后 经过测试,无论你用何种方式修改密码,OWA 还是命令行,效果都是一样;在未加域服务器上效果也是一样 如果想要立即获取某个用户密码,在域控上轻轻一勾即可 “User must change

    70390

    密码如何保护区块链

    这是一个很重要特点,因为比特币一个非常直接密码学应用。 密码学并不是一种未经考验新技术。比特币所使用所有密码学技术自互联网诞生以来一直都在使用着,每天使用许多常见互联网协议重要部分。 计算机科学家认为密码可靠和必要,就像NASA(美国国家航空航天局)认为宇航科学可靠和必要一样。 公私钥对:密码基石 公私钥对区块链所使用密码基石。公私钥对包含两部分:私钥和公钥。 这两个密钥实际上只不过具有特定数学关系大整数,用于代替密码和用户名。 足够大整数 在此之前,我简单地提到了私钥和公钥功能就像用户名和密码一样,但实际上它们只不过具有特殊数学关系大整数。 为了使私钥“免疫”于暴力破解,我们只需要添加足够数字——我们只需要使它们足够大。 那多大足够大?比特币中使用私钥256比特整数,相当于一个长度为76位数字。这一数字大小令人难以置信

    650150

    网页上账号、密码登陆验证,如何实现

    需求 我们在日常上网过程中,常常会使用很多注册、登录我们账号和密码环节。这是网页开发中必不可少一个环节。本文中将利用Java+Tomcat完成一个简单账号、密码登录网页。 功能 首先,需要让用户输入自己账号和密码。在输入用户自己账号和密码后,点击登录,将会自动进行验证。 ? 当账号和密码与自己提前存入账号密码相对应时候,网页将会显示用户账号名,并提示正确。 当账号密码错误时,网页会提示密码错误。 ? 程序 本功能实现主要通过两个页面进行实现,首先是一个登录页面,里面放置用户进行输入账号和密码,及登录跳转程序,也就是我们后面的from.jsp。 另外一个验证界面,也就是page.jsp文件。主要功能验证密码正确与否,并进行相关页面的显示。这其中逻辑关系本程序重点。 :<input name="account" type="text">
    请输入你密码:<input name="password" type="password">

    2.3K30

    程序员怎么记住一堆密码

    引言 在我们生活和工作当中,会用到非常多网络应用,因为并不是每个应用都能用类似QQ/微信一键登录方式来绑定账号,所以也就有了非常多账号密码,记密码成为了让我们非常头疼事情。 太简单或者过于单一密码容易被撞库或“脱裤”,而太复杂密码又难以记忆。 因此,市面上就有了多款帮助我们记录密码软件服务,比如1password、Lastpass等。 因为腾讯云CDN支持自定义端口源站,所以上一步反向代理在使用腾讯云CDN方案下可以忽略不做。 Bitwarden密码保存提示 只要我们点击保存,下次再打开这个页面Bitwarden就能自动填充账号密码信息,如果有多个账号,则需要点击小盾牌图标从列表里面选择一个账号来填充: ? 数据备份 数据备份本身就是一个老生常谈、不能忽视关键节点,更别提我们密码数据了!因此,对于Bitwarden我们还需要设置下定时数据备份。

    37531

    什么相干时间和相干长度

    上学时候估计学到过,例如光干涉原理。 如上图获得相干光方法,双缝衍射出现明暗条纹。 相干光就是频率\偏振\和传播方向相同光波。 通常我们定性地用杨氏双缝干涉实验干涉条纹清晰程度来判别光束相干性程度。 激光是一种什么样相干光   激光方向性,我们一般用光束发散角来定义,而激光空间相干性和方向性紧密关联。 光源原子一次发光时间越长,通过双缝干涉观察到条纹越多,我们就说时间相干性越长,而光源原子发光时间我们就称为相干时间,相干时间内波列长度叫做相干长度。 相干长度L越长,干涉条纹越清晰,表示相干性越好。 激光是一种什么样相干光   对于激光来说,属于同一个横模光子都是空间相干,不属于同一个横模光子则是不相干。 由此可见,单模激光空间相干性最好

    57410

    关于laravel 数据库迁移中integer类型无法指定长度问题

    laravel数据库迁移中integer类型无法指定长度,很多小伙伴对integer类型传递第二个参数后会发现迁移报以下错误 Syntax error or access violation: 1075 definition; there can be only one auto column and it must be defined as a key 查看了sql代码后发现通过integer指定长度创建子段自动添加了 auto increament 以及 primary key 属性 int not null auto_increment primary key 查看源代码后发现integer方法第二个参数并不是指定长度 ,而是是否设置auto increment,所以integer方法无法指定子段长度,默认为11。 addColumn('integer', $column, compact('autoIncrement', 'unsigned')); } 以上这篇关于laravel 数据库迁移中integer类型无法指定长度问题就是小编分享给大家全部内容了

    42331

    如何通过网络摄像头分析wifi密码

    看到 exploit-db.com 中报了一个《Netwave IP Camera - Password Disclosure》漏洞, 这个漏洞包含了wifi密码与Web账号泄露。 这里近分析了中国香港地区摄像头: 无wifi密码962个 WEP加密方式728个 WPAPSK加密方式9496个 查询看密码 密码类型统计 存数字 1807 个 存字母 1405 个 字母+数字 5585 个 含特殊字符 1001 个 密码最多TOP 10 ? 密码长度统计 ? 看出大众还是使用8位、10位密码较多。 ? 附上一张中国香港分析后图, 红色代表没有密码wifi, 黄色代表WEP加密方式, 蓝色代表WPAPSK方式。 ? 这个世界范围内存在摄像头密码泄漏分布图。 这张图示根据SSID搜索到一家公司内IP摄像头截图。

    45210

    网页上账号、密码登陆验证,如何实现?(二)比对数据库中账号密码

    需求 通过在页面输入账号密码,实现从数据库查询数据并返回,验证成功后登录,打开主界面。 ? SqlDataReader sqlDataReader = sqlCommand.ExecuteReader(); if (sqlDataReader.HasRows)//满足用户名与密码一致 Show(); this.Hide(); } else MessageBox.Show("账号密码不正确

    90810

    解锁智能锁下半场密码:技术依然核心

    “家”不容侵犯,锁守护着家庭安全入口,但传统锁一直存在着带钥匙累赘、忘带和弄丢钥匙麻烦等痛点,智能锁在保障安全防盗同时,支持密码、指纹、人脸或手机等解锁方式,一经面世就被证明刚需型产品。 经过多年市场教育与产品进化后,智能锁市场在这几年又迎来了多重增长机会:国人居住升级浪潮下,精装修、全屋智能等居住潮流兴起;疫情影响下,“无接触”成为新生活方式;家政等到家服务日益普及,临时密码等远程开锁模式日益流行 ”伤害整个行业。 另一方面,解锁方式场景化、个性化、人性化,比如临时密码可解决家政人员上门需求,德施曼最新发布Q50FMax甚至可提供10种解锁方式。 放眼未来,智能锁开锁方式依然有较大技术想象空间。 此前,包括德施曼在内头部品牌已在强化两个维度安全,一个锁本身安全,如防撬锁、防攻击等核心技术,涉及到锁体、解锁机构、快开机构、离合机构、机械密码等机械安全,以及互联网安全。

    10020

    扫码关注腾讯云开发者

    领取腾讯云代金券